#a20347 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a20347 is composed of 63.5% red, 1.2%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.1% magenta, 56.2%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 334.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.4% and a lightness of 32.4%. #a20347 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ff068e with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

Shades and Tints of #a20347
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080003 is the darkest color, while #fff4f8 is the lightest one.
